Advancements in Genomic Sequencing
Recent breakthroughs in genomic sequencing technologies have significantly reduced the cost and time required to sequence an individual's entire genome. This has paved the way for more accurate and personalized treatment plans based on a patient's unique genetic makeup.
AI and Machine Learning in Precision Medicine
The use of artificial intelligence and machine learning algorithms has revolutionized the analysis of complex biological data, enabling healthcare providers to identify patterns and correlations that were previously undetectable. This has led to more precise diagnostics and treatment recommendations.
Targeted Therapies and Immunotherapy
Advancements in targeted therapies and immunotherapy have allowed for the development of treatments that specifically target the genetic mutations or biomarkers driving a patient's disease. This approach has shown promising results in various types of cancer and other diseases.
Integration of Big Data and Electronic Health Records
The integration of big data analytics and electronic health records has enabled healthcare providers to leverage vast amounts of patient data to identify trends, predict disease progression, and tailor treatment plans to individual patients. This has led to more personalized and effective healthcare delivery.
